当前位置:首页 > 服务器技术 > 正文

魔兽世界服务器维护技术教程

引言

在多人在线游戏如《魔兽世界》中,服务器维护是确保游戏稳定运行的关键。本文将详细介绍如何进行服务器维护,包括数据库备份、性能监控及常见问题解决。通过本文,你将学会如何有效地管理和维护你的游戏服务器。

数据库备份

数据库是存储游戏数据的核心,定期备份至关重要。以下是如何使用MySQL进行数据库备份的步骤:

mysqldump -u username -p database_name > backup_file.sql

此命令将数据库`database_name`导出为`backup_file.sql`。请确保你有足够的权限执行此操作,并且备份文件存储在安全的位置。

实测在Linux环境下执行此命令,未出现权限问题,但需要注意密码输入时的安全性。

性能监控

性能监控是确保服务器稳定运行的关键。以下是几个常用的监控工具及其功能:

  • top: 实时显示系统任务及资源使用情况。
  • htop: 更友好的进程查看工具,需先安装。
  • iostat: 监控I/O设备性能。

通过结合这些工具,你可以全面了解服务器的健康状况。

常见问题及解决

在服务器维护过程中,可能会遇到一些常见问题。以下是几个常见问题及其解决方案:

  • 问题: 数据库连接失败
    原因: 可能是数据库服务未启动或端口配置错误
    解决: 检查服务状态并确认端口配置正确。
  • 问题: 备份文件过大
    原因: 数据库数据量增长过快
    解决: 考虑使用增量备份或压缩备份文件。

进阶方向

随着你的技能提升,可以考虑以下进阶方向:

  1. 深入学习数据库优化,提高查询效率。
  2. 掌握容器化技术,如Docker,以简化服务器管理。
  3. 研究分布式系统架构,以应对更大规模的游戏社区。